Brief Summary

The aim of the study is, to study the efficacy of the ketogenic diet in delaying or preventing recurrence and tumor growth progression of patients who have been previously treated by concomitant chemoradiotherapy (6 months) for high-grade glial tumors. It will be an open-label trial of nutritional intervention for up to 1 year. An interim analysis of the data will be carried out to assess safety, compliance and efficacy of the diet. This will be reviewed by both SHS and the Clinical trial team.

Outcome Measures

Primary Outcomes (1)

  • To study the effect of the ketogenic diet on tumor growth progression and longevity in patients with Malignant glioblastoma.

    This will be done by comparing tumor size by repeated MRI studies (every 2 months)

Secondary Outcomes (1)

  • Quality of life

You may qualify if:

  • Consenting adults aged ≥ 18 years.
  • Recurrent or progressive high grade glioma after failure of at least one line of standard oncological treatment.
  • Gliomatosis cerebri, including patients declining radiation treatment.

You may not qualify if:

  • Patients with malignant tumors who are receiving treatment at the time of the recruitment.
  • Early termination - patients who will wish to stop their participation in the trial will discontinue the ketogenic diet and return to their usual diet.
